China’s Shenzhou 16 astronauts (or taikonauts, as Chinese language spaceflyers are recognized) launched to the nation’s Tiangong house station aboard a Lengthy March 2F rocket in Might 2023. The crew consists of commander Jing Haipeng, spaceflight engineer Zhu Yangzhu and payload specialist Gui Haichao.

The trio has spent round 5 months aboard the orbital laboratory conducting a variety of scientific experiments and public outreach. Zhu and Jing additionally executed an eight-hour spacewalk in June 2023 to carry out upkeep on cameras aboard Tiangong. Tonight, all eyes are again on the crew as their Shenzhou spacecraft is ready to the touch down on the Dongfeng Touchdown Web site in China’s Inside Mongolia Autonomous Area.

Shenzhou-16’s substitute crew, Shenzhou-17, arrived at Tiangong simply days in the past. “Construct a dream on the Tiangong house station and proceed to work laborious,” the brand new crew stated in unison together with the three homebound astronauts they changed throughout a welcome ceremony (translation by Chinese language broadcaster CCTV, which livestreamed the occasion). “China’s house station is all the time price trying ahead to.”

The newly-arrived Shenzhou 17 crew consists of mission commander Tang Hongbo, aged 48, and former Folks’s Liberation Military Air Pressure (PLAAF) fighter pilots Tang Shengjie, aged 34, and Jiang Xinlin, aged 35. They’re the seventh and youngest crew to go to Tiangong so far.

Tiangong is about one-fifth the scale of the Worldwide Area Station, and was simply accomplished in late 2022 with the addition of its third and remaining part, the Mengtian module.
